Armor Division deploys for historic BARMM elecytions; reactivates DMIC to boost readiness 
Camp O'Donnel., Brgy. Sta. Lucia, Capas, Tarlac — The Armor (Pambato) Division, Philippine Army, led by Major General Ronel R. Manalo PA, conducted a send-off ceremony for Tank Platoons, a Security Platoon, and the Division Mechanized Infantry Company (DMIC) – Dismounted, alongside its formal reactivation, at the Pambato Clubhouse. These actions support the Philippine Army’s election-security mission for the historic first Bangsamoro Autonomous Region in Muslim Mindanao (BARMM) Parliamentary Elections on September 14, 2026.

The deployment of forces underscores the Armor Division’s distinct role as the Philippine Army’s decisive arm, capable of delivering overwhelming firepower, rapid maneuver, and unyielding force protection in support of national objectives. Tank Platoons serve as visible deterrence and rapid-response capability; the Security Platoon fortifies ground stability; and the DMIC expands operational reach, strengthening forces in Mindanao to ensure absolute readiness and flexibility throughout election duty.

Army reinforces Lanao del Sur security ahead of BARMM Elections
The Philippine Army, as the largest force provider to the Armed Forces of the Philippines, reinforced election security in Lanao del Sur as ground units deployed Sabrah light tanks, ATMOS 155mm wheeled self-propelled artillery systems, additional ground troops ahead of the Bangsamoro Parliamentary Elections (BPE) on September 14, 2026.

The deployment forms part of the Army’s sustained and comprehensive election security measures, which include the strategic positioning and movement of troops and assets to areas requiring additional security support. The Sabrah light tanks and ATMOS 155mm wheeled self-propelled artillery systems will augment the armored and fire support assets already prepositioned in Lanao del Sur, alongside the 10 battalions currently deployed in the area. The 29th and 30th Infantry Battalions will also be deployed as follow-on infantry forces.

Army units, which form a crucial part of Joint Security Control Centers with the PNP and Comelec, are firmly committed to ensuring that Bangsamoro voters can freely elect their next leaders free from any threat. (Philippine Army)
